Nachstehend werden alle möglichen XML-Tags und dessen Attribute aufgelistet und erläutert.
XML-Tag | Beschreibung | |
---|---|---|
<condition></condition> | Gehört in das Element <documents> und beschreibt ein Grabzustandsbrief | |
<configuration></configuration> | Das Root-Element für alle Einstellungen wie zum Beispiel Benutzerdefinierte Datenfelder | |
<customfields></customfields> | Gehört in das Element <configuration> und enthält alle benutzerdefinierten Datenfelder
| |
<datenfeld></<datenfeld> | ||
<document></document> | Gehört in das Element <documents> und beschreibt ein Dokument oder Serienbrief | |
<documents></documents> | Das Root-Element für alle Dokumente | |
<format></format> | ||
<invoice></invoice> | Gehört in das Element <documents> und beschreibt ein Dokument als Bescheid/Rechnung | |
<maxtextlength></maxtextlength> | Gehört in das Element <configuration> und gibt an nach wie viel Zeichen ein Datenfeld umgebrochen werden soll | |
<statement></statement> | ||
<templates></templates> | Gehört in die Elemente <invoice>, <document> oder <condition> und enthält alle Templatevorlagen zu dem jeweiligen Dokument | |
<winfried></winfried> | Ist das Root-Element in dem alle anderen Tags eingebunden werden |
Nachfolgende Attribute gehören zu den Tags <invoice>, <document> und <condition> | |||
---|---|---|---|
Attribut | Beschreibung | ||
id | Ist eine Nummer durch die das jeweilige Dokument eindeutig erkannt werden kann. Die id darf in der documents.config nicht doppelt vorkommen | ||
plugin | Gibt an in welchem Plugin das Dokument angezeigt werden soll Zum Beispiel GB für Gebührenbescheid | ||
visible_name | Ist der Text/Name der in WinFried angezeigt wird.
| ||
path | Ist der Pfad zum Dokument im Berichte-Verzeichnis. Hier kann ein absoluter oder relativer Pfad angegeben werden
| ||
add_to_dms | Gibt an ob das Dokument nach dem Drucken in das Dokumentenarchiv gespeichert werden soll | ||
fkkgb | Hier muss die Gebührenbescheidnr. angegeben werden damit WinFried weiß welches Dokument bei einem Gebührenbescheid geöffnet werden muss
| ||
zahler | Kann die von WinFried verwendete Reihenfolge zum Ermitteln des Gebührenpflichtigen manipulieren. Beispiel zahler="BS"
| ||
group | Gibt an zu welcher Zustandsgruppe der Grabzustandsbrief gehört
| ||
letter | Gibt an welches Schreiben der Grabzustandsbrief ist. Maximal 3 Schreiben sind möglich
| ||
lock | Sperrt das Formular. Es sind keine manuellen Eingaben möglich. Wird zum Beispiel verwendet wenn nur Word Steuerelemente ausgefüllt werden sollen. Beispiel lock="true"
| ||
mailmerge | Gibt an ob das Schreiben für den Seriendruck verfügbar ist | ||
kfh | Gibt an unter welchen Friedhof das Schreiben verfügbar ist |
Nachfolgende Attribute gehören zum Tag <template> | ||
---|---|---|
Attribut | Beschreibung | |
path | Ist der Pfad zur Templatevorlage im Berichte-Verzeichnis. Hier kann ein absoluter Pfad angegeben werden (nicht empfohlen) oder ein relativer Pfad | |
bookmark | Ist der Name der Textmarke im Word-Dokument um an dieser Stelle die Templatevorlage zu laden | |
load_first | Gibt an welche Templatevorlage vor dem eigentlichen Dokument geladen werden soll
|
Nachfolgende Attribute gehören zu den Elementen im Tag <maxtextlength> | ||
---|---|---|
Attribut | Beschreibung | |
ignoredocs | Hiermit kann, anhand der id, angegeben werden bei welchen Dokumenten die Textlängen des jeweiligen Datenfeldes nicht überprüft werden sollen
|